Where can I get a copy of MacOS Monterey 12.6.8 that is from Apple? I've downloaded a .pkg copy from a website on the Internet but haven't installed it yet. Is it safe? I'd prefer to download a copy from Apple but I don't know where to find it.

I want to do a clean install onto my iMac HDD by first putting Monterey 12.6.8 onto an APFS (Encrypted) formatted USB SSD drive. Then, after I've wiped my HDD, I want to install the bootable OS from the SSD drive to my iMac (late 2015, 27" desktop) HDD.


The .pkg does not have a lock or any kind of authentication symbol in the upper right hand corner.

Is it safe to install? If not, where can I download a copy of this OS software from Apple?

Never install any Apple application or installer that you did not directly obtain from Apple. Otherwise, you have zero assurance that the content will be safe from mal-intent.
